Output 3d120cedd025c8b4bf0cd39d5ba71b1e7df60f0d47150254c0bb1979e93f4cda:0

value
15731092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d2ad0058465211d2e024dd36168d53dcf475261 OP_EQUAL
address
MLmao9ajcSh6GR76oVN3EPgDcoBTac2QqE
transaction
3d120cedd025c8b4bf0cd39d5ba71b1e7df60f0d47150254c0bb1979e93f4cda
spent
true